How do you get monsters? The monsters that you fight need to be lured to you. You must fight them and before or during the fight feed them treats. The more expensive the treat the better the monsters will like it. The monster you fight and beat last might join your party. What about Boss Monsters? Each boss monster is pre-decided to join your group. Don't bother wasting your treats on them. If you do defeat them they join your party. As the game gets harder, the bosses stop joining. Monster Farm =============================================================== You can take only 3 with you. The rest must stay in the farm and rest. When the monsters stay in the farm they do get some EXP. They get less than the active members of your party, but they get some. The sleeping monsters do not receive EXPs. You should rotate each gate with sleeping and not sleeping monsters. This will give everyone some EXP. Monsters Level up just like the characters in the previous DW games. Some spells level up in the game creating a more powerful effect then the previous one. There are a few catches, they can only learn a certain amount of spells, so each time a monster develops a new spell they must forget one. It is up to you to decide which spells get cut. They also have a limit to the levels. The other catch is some monsters can level up quickly. You can find them in the stats next to their names. Here is a simple chart to explain ML: Max Level The Max Level of a wild-caught monster is this value +/- 2 (random) The Max Level of a bred monster is this value + Plus * 2 XP: XP/Level table This is a pointer to one of 32 different XP tables. In general, the higher the number, the more XP the monster needs per level: 00-07 = Fast (2 XP for level 2) 08-15 = Normal (5 XP for level 2) 16-23 = Slow (10 XP for level 2) 24-31 = Very slow (100 XP for level 2) IV. Monster Families =============================================================== Each monster is in their own family from one of the ten families that there are, each family has special abilities. Look at the description below. a. Devil Family - i. This monster family has the following traits: High HP, Attack, and Defense. They can withstand strong Magic Attacks and some special skills. b. Bug Family - i. The Bug Family is very strong against poison attacks and have great capacity for increasing their attack and defense strengths. c. Slime Family - i. The Slime Family may seem weak, but is one of the better families. The Healer can support the other monsters while the High Defense of the Metal King and Gold Slime can come in handy, unfortunately these two suffer from low hp. Others in the family however grow rapidly and are quick. d. Dragon Family - i. High in all areas, especially defensively against fire and blizzard attacks, the Dragon Family is a force to be reckoned with. Unfortunately, they go quite slowly. Mini Dragon is a good one. e. Beast Family - i. The beast families specialty is to resist most special skills that lower level monsters can dish out. They are also good attackers and have high HP. f. Bird Family - i. These monsters are resistant to lightning and fly. Some have flame attacks. g. Plant Family - i. Plants are the smartest of the bunch, as they have the highest intelligence and MP of the families. But their agility is low, but then again they can grow to very high levels. h. Zombie Family - i. This group has strong HP levels, but on everything else are just average, and are weak against paralysis. i. Materials Family - i. Being made from mainly non-living things, the material family has high resistance against fire and ice and good defense overall. j. Boss Family - i. Most of the old bosses in the Dragon Warrior games are actually in the monster lists. Some you have to breed, you can even get the Dragon Lord from DWI, II. V. Monster Breeding =============================================================== This is one of the most confusing and exciting part of the game. Make sure you know what monsters you are breeding and that they are male and female. Once you breed two monsters they will leave your party permanently. Before you rush into breeding you must understand how the breeding works. When two monsters create a egg their skills are passed on. If you mate a fire skilled monster with a lightning type monster you create a monster that can develop fire and lightning magic. A monster can only get skills that their parents have already learned. Spells can also get combined. Which can make a more powerful spell with two spells. Some of them need to be combined. Here are the best spells for monsters: Hell Blast Multi Cut K.O. Dance Big Bang Mega Magic Gig Slash If there are more send them to Dragonmaster@dragonwarrior2000.every1.net Now another key is the pedigree of the monster. When you mate two monsters the first one is the pedigree. The monster will most likely be born as a type of the monster. A bird pedigree will most likely make a flying type monster.
